Success StoriesWeapons Charge Reduced To No Jail Time After Wallin & Klarich RetainedOur client was charged with brandishing a firearm in public. The charge carried a mandatory 90 days in county jail. The client insisted that he had pointed his finger, and the alleged victim was more than 50 feet away when he says he saw a gun. The client did have a gun similar to the one described by the victim. This looked like a good case for trial, but the client was interested in a plea if he could avoid jail time. When the judge heard that we were going to trial, he discussed the case with us and agreed that the client should not have to do jail time. Result: Our client spent no time in custody. |
